Here are some steps you can follow after your accident:
- Talk to the Police
Get a copy of the police report. If a police officer came to the scene, get his name and badge number. If the police didn’t come to the scene, you may have to go to the police station to pick up the report or file a report there. This information can be useful in your case. - Collect the Facts
- Try to get the names, addresses, phone numbers, and any other contact information for anyone who was involved in or witnessed your wreck.
- Get the insurance information for the other parties involved. This may be listed in the police report, but if not, it’s helpful to have that information on hand.
- Draw a diagram or write a detailed description of the car wreck. Make sure you note the lane and direction you were traveling, as well as the direction and lane of any other vehicles involved.
- See Your Doctor!
Even if you don’t think you need to see a doctor, we advise all of our clients who have been in a car wreck to see a physician as soon as possible because some injuries take time to present themselves.
